Palace Court Football Club are located in the village of Marnhull in north Dorset, six miles south west of Shaftesbury. Dorchester and Sherborne are the nearest large towns.

Marnhull is two and a half miles off the A30 Shaftesbury to Sherborne road, leave the A30 at East Stour and take the B3092 into the village coming through Stour Provost and Todber. Turn right as you reach a sign for the village and follow the road for half a mile, at the end of this road you will come to a T-junction, where you will see a garage directly infront of you. Turn right at the T-junction, and then next right again through a pair of black iron gates. The village hall, pavillion, and football pitch are at the top of the drive.

The nearest rail links to Marnhull are Gillingham (Dorset), and Templecombe, both are six miles from the village and situated on the Exeter St Davids to London Waterloo line.
